Fancy finding out more about farm and farmers?
Well you will soon be able to explore the lesser-known roads around the region, and meet farmers and experience local farming life on homesteads not usually open to the public.
The Hastings Landcare Farm Gate Tour is a self-drive program in the Hastings, Port Macquarie and Camden Haven area, with farm tours at set times over three days - Saturday June 11, Sunday June 12 and Monday June 13.
Organiser Kerry Wehlburg says historically the tour attracts visits from Sydney north to the Hastings area.
"Ten farms will be opening their gates; including a pasture raised egg business, farms growing garlic, avocados, a cattle stud enterprise and more."
